Just found this info on another expats forum re EDP:
According to AFPOP (association for property owners in Portugal), the 2 year transitional period starts in July for customers with contracts above 10.35kva.
During this period, the regulated prices remain in effect and so does the bi-horario rates. For customers with contracts to supply under 10.35kva, the transitional period starts in July 2014. |
